Figure 3: Test procedure for the swift modified alkali resistance test (SMART) as presently practiced by the “Task force on Assessment and Evaluation of Irritant Skin Damages” of the ABD

Test site: medial forearm, ventral. The same procedure is performed for the differential irritation test (DIT), when the SMART is carried out in parallel on the back of the hand corresponding to chirality and the contralateral forearm. TEWL = transepidermal waterloss. Clinical and biophysical readings are to be conducted 10 min after the second provocation phase.
